Approval of a 0.808 acre sanitary sewer easement agreement between the City of New Braunfels and New Braunfels Utilities over and across 55.139 acres out of the J. Thompson Survey number 21, Abstract 608, Comal County, Texas located at 1946 Monarch Way, identified as Fischer Park.

 

Body

BACKGROUND / RATIONALE:

The New Braunfels Utilities South Kuehler Road Interceptor sanitary sewer easement currently crosses a portion of Fischer Park in the vicinity of the Nature Center and Archaeology Pit.  This sanitary sewer line is in need of replacement and in order to minimize the impact to park facilities, NBU has proposed a new easement alignment which is shown on the exhibit attached to this agenda report. 

 

Staff has met and discussed the terms of this agreement with NBU who has agreed to have their contractor meet certain conditions regarding timing of construction and restoration of landscaping, trees and other park improvements.  The construction activities are proposed to take place within Fischer Park between October 1, 2018 and March 31, 2019.

 

ADDRESSES A NEED/ISSUE IN A CITY PLAN OR COUNCIL PRIORITY:

 

 

 

 

 

 

FISCAL IMPACT:

There is no compensation due from NBU as part of this easement agreement.
